How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Pawling?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Pawling Studio Apartments | $1,852 | $1,200 | $4,711 |
Pawling 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,551 | $1,275 | $4,910 |
Pawling 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,031 | $1,685 | $5,851 |
Pawling 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,409 | $2,710 | $5,390 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
